AbstractThis manuscript concerns the fuzzy differential equation involving ψ-Hilfer type fractional derivative with nonlocal condition. By using successive approximation, we obtain the existence, uniqueness results of solution for ψ-Hilfer fuzzy differential equation. Further, nonlocal conditions are extended to the existence results. Furthermore, an application is shown to demonstrate the theoretical conclusions utility.

AbstractIn this work, we investigate the existence of solutions for Hadamard fractional differential equations with integral boundary conditions in a Banach space. We will make use the measure of noncompactness and the Monch fixed point theorem to prove the ¨ main results. An example is given to illustrate our results.
